<< SO I have this Sequential Circuits Tom Drum Machine.  I just got a new 
power supply for it,  The unit will turn on a perform all functions except 
the drum pads do not trigger any sounds.  So I squeezed in the contemporary 
cartridge and still nothing, no sound.  I am ssuming my power supply is 
working(otherwise unit would not turn on)  So then I thought is was my 
outputs, but the Metronome function works great and I hear a steady click.  
So I opened the unit up everything is there, no missing chips no cut bridges 
and no fried parts.  Has anybody ever had a similar problem?  Any ideas? >>

Have you tried playing the sounds from MIDI?  Maybe the machine has a MIDI 
"Local On/Off" function that needs to be toggled.  You could also try sending 
it some MIDI Volume control messages (controller #7 at a value of 127) - 
maybe someone previously the set volume to zero.
